Abstract :
Sensor transmission interval optimization problem is considered for network monitoring systems. Under limited network bandwidth, a method to choose an optimal transmission period for each sensor is proposed based on the periodic solution of Kalman filters. Through simulation and experiments using CAN network, the proposed method is verified
